Subject: Quickstore 4.2 — bloom filter now fronts the KV layer

Plugin authors: starting with this release, Quickstore places a bloom filter ahead of the key-value store. Negative lookups return faster; false positives fall through safely. No API changes are required on your side. Verify your plugin against the staging build referenced below.

session token of fahif-tadup = htk3_9c7

**Q: My snapshot tests keep failing after upgrading the Plumwick SDK — what gives?**

Short answer: our renderer now normalizes whitespace in component trees, so old snapshots won't match. Just regenerate them with `plumwick snap --update` and commit the new files. If you need to restore the signing vault for the snapshot registry first, use the recovery passphrase below.

strongbox words: raleth-ralvan-aldiel-ulaax-istix-zorok-kelax-kelox-wenix-zormir-aldix-silael-normir

Restockly generates nightly restock routes for the Vendabright machine fleet. If the planner job fails or routes are missing by 05:00, retry once via the scheduler console. Check the demand-forecast feed first; a stale feed causes silent empty plans. Do not hand-edit routes in production. If retry fails or drivers report missing manifests after 06:00, escalate to the Planning Systems rotation. Severity-2 if fewer than half the depots are affected; Severity-1 otherwise. For escalation, contact the Planning Systems duty inbox.

escalation mailbox, bafog-fafog: ulador@paliqlabs.internal

Changelog — EchoDocent 3.1

Changed defaults, flagged for security review: the museum audio-guide app now requires TLS 1.3 for tour-content downloads, anonymous session tokens expire after 24 hours instead of 30 days, and beacon-based location logging is opt-in rather than opt-out. Offline packs are now signed at build time. The shipped defaults are listed here.

service settings:
WENATH_PIN=5007
WENATH_METRICS_HOST=metrics.wenath.tolvaqlabs.corp
WENATH_LOG_LEVEL=debug
WENATH_TENANT=rusox